CHICKEN FEED FOR LITTLE BIRDS

Du mouron pour les petits oiseaux

Directed by Marcel Carné
France, Italy, 1963
Comedy

Synopsis

Mr. Armand, a former mobster, has become the respectable owner of a building. In the same house, Lucie supports her lover by sleeping with the butcher, while the butcher’s wife has her own lover–his assistant. Their lives are thrown together when a tenant dies and the police show up to investigate.

Our take

A popular Albert Simonin adaptation, Marcel Carné’s ensemble comedy is a late-career triumph, its host of eccentric characters recalling the rambunctious atmosphere of his Hôtel du Nord classic. A delectable tale for the senses where romance, mystery, and even gourmet food pleasurably intertwine.
